Catherine Crier, former judge and Emmy-winning journalist, talked about her book Patriot Acts: What Americans Must Do to Save the Republic. She gives her analysis of the partisan politics that she argues are hurting the United States and suggests what will and won’t work for America today.
This interview was held at the 34th Annual National Press Club Book Fair and Authors' Night, a fundraiser for the Eric Friedheim National Journalism Library held Tuesday, November 15, 2011, from 5:30 to 8:30 p.m. close
